Carter Family Fold and its collection

Carter Family Fold
Source

The Carter Family Fold, located near Hiltons, Virginia, is a concert venue that is dedicated to the preservation and performance of old time country and bluegrass music. Named in honor of the original Carter Family, who were among the earliest recording artists in country music, the Fold was founded in 1979 by Janette Carter, the daughter of A.P. and Sara Carter. The venue presents weekly concerts and is known for its commitment to musical preservation, with no electric instruments allowed. However, exceptions were made for performances by singer Johnny Cash, a Carter family in-law.

Dance at the Fold

The Carter Family Fold is not just a concert venue, but also a place where local forms of folk dancing, such as Appalachian buckdancing and clogging, can be seen on a weekly basis. The dance floor is a central part of the Fold, providing a space for visitors to engage with the music in a more physical way and to experience a piece of local culture.

The Carter Family Memorial Music Center

The Carter Family Fold is the centerpiece of the Carter Family Memorial Music Center, a non-profit organization. The Fold is more than just a concert venue, it also includes the 1880s cabin where A. P. Carter, one of the original members of the Carter Family, was born. This cabin was moved from its original location to a site next to the Fold and has been refurbished and rededicated.

Seating and Tickets at the Fold

The Carter Family Fold has a seating capacity of 842. Visitors wishing to attend a Saturday night show will usually find ample seating. However, for gospel and other special shows, it is advisable to request tickets well in advance. This ensures that visitors can secure a seat and fully enjoy the performances.
